Inches of mercury is the unit of pressure, usually used in weather reports.
1 atm is equal to 29.92 inches of mercury. In the question, 30.4 inches of mercury is mentioned so atmospheric pressure will be , ( 30.4 × 1) / 29.92 = 1.016 atm.
